The majority of real-life problems are characterized by multiple conflicting objectives. The problem can therefore be viewed as a multiobjective optimization problem. The concept of health care is defined as the maintenance or improvement of health by preventing, diagnosing, and treating diseases, illnesses, injuries, and other physical and mental handicaps. Health care is delivered by health professionals who specialize in allied health fields. The concept of smart healthcare is basically transforming the traditional healthcare system all around to be more efficient, convenient, and personalized.
The main objective of this book is to encourage various researchers, students, academicians, and professionals to apply multioptimization approaches to improve the healthcare industry's performance. It will help them solve their daily life problems quickly and efficiently.
